Ages A box plot showing ages of different students in maths class. outliers are 20 and 28. Median is 22.5. Lower quartile is 21.5  and upper quartile is 24.5. The ages of 8 different students in a college math class were used to make the box plot shown above. Which of the following numbers below is the range of the ages? A. 8 B. 18 C. 3 D. 5

Final answer:

The range of ages in the given college math class is 8, calculated by subtracting the smallest age (20) from the largest age (28).

Step-by-step explanation:

You are asking about the range of ages for a college math class based on a box plot. The range of a dataset is the difference between the largest and smallest values. According to the information provided, the outliers are age 20 and age 28. To calculate the range, you subtract the smallest age from the largest age.

So, the range of the ages would be:

Range = Largest age − Smallest age
Range = 28 − 20
Range = 8

Therefore, the correct answer is A. 8.
